타입스크립트 - 타입 선언과 변경, 타입호환

타입 에일리어스(type alias)

타입 에일이어스는 타입스크립트 1.4 버전부터 지원된 특징입니다. 타입 에일리어스를 이용하면 기존 타입에 새로운 이름을 지을 수 있습니다.

[형식]
type<바인딩 식별자> = 타입;

바인딩 식별자(binding identifier)는 타입의 별칭에 해당하는 타입 에일라어스입니다.
타입에 새로운 별칭을 만드는 과정을 줄여서 에일리어싱(aliasing)이라고 합니다.

타입스크립트 - 고급타입

유니언 타입

유니언 타입은 타입스크립트 1.4에 추가된 특징입니다. 유니언타입은 2개 이상의 타입을 하나의 타입으로 정의한 타입입니다.
유니언 타입을 선언 할 때는 파이프(|)를 타입명 사이에 넣습니다.

타입A | 타입B | 타입C …

유니언 타입으로 선언된 변수는 나열된 타입 중 하나의 타입에 속한 값만 할당 받습니다.

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×